Geographical Location
The first thing to consider when discussing goose hunting season is where you’re located. Each state has its own set of rules and regulations regarding when it’s permitted to hunt geese. It’s essential that you check with your state wildlife agency or department before planning a trip. Some states have specific dates for different types of geese, such as snow geese, while others may have restrictions on certain areas where goose hunting isn’t allowed at all.
Hunting Season Dates
In general, most states’ goose seasons take place in the fall and winter months when these birds migrate southward from their breeding grounds in Canada and northern regions of the United States. The exact dates vary by location but typically range from September or October through late January or early February. It’s crucial that hunters familiarize themselves with their state’s particular guidelines because penalties for breaking them can be severe.
